"Suicide Prevention Is Everyone's Business" Suicide Awareness for Older Adults (.pdf) The Suicide Prevention Subcommittee of the Governor's Council continues to grow in membership and activities. It began as a loose-knit group of Kansans concerned about reducing suicide in our state. Several of those people participated in regional and nation suicide prevention conferences that preceded former Surgeon General David Satcher's Call To Action To Prevent Suicide, and National Strategy for Suicide Prevention.
